scooter3 Posted August 14, 2009 Report Share Posted August 14, 2009 I finally got the ride all cleaned up. Took some new paint and a rotary buffer to get the shine back. The paint was so bad that there are still a few areas that would not clean up. A lot of etching from bird droppings and sun damage on the tops of the bumpers. The guy who owned it did not take very good care of the outside or interior. It looks a ton better now though. Had to get the scoop and spoiler repainted. Needed new headlights and taillights. Also needed a new trunk mat since he spilled paint all over it. Detailed the interior, wheels and engine. I installed a stubby antenna, dash mat and put 6000K HID's in and some new tint. Now all I need are some performance parts to go faster. Car is a blast to drive and still only has a little over 18,000 miles. Well here are some before and after pics. Enjoy.
